Q: Is 50,471,667 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 50,471,667 is a composite number.

Why is 50,471,667 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 50,471,667 can be evenly divided by 1 3 9 27 81 623,107 1,869,321 5,607,963 16,823,889 and 50,471,667, with no remainder.

Since 50,471,667 cannot be divided by just 1 and 50,471,667, it is a composite number.
